Wah I Neva Kno is a Caymanian digital heritage project created to make our history, culture, and stories easier to understand and more engaging for younger generations. Through a mix of short-form videos, articles, and a website, the project answers questions about the Cayman Islands that many people have never thought to ask—or simply never knew the answer to.

As a Caymanian student and content creator, I wanted to create something that went beyond a traditional academic project. My goal was to take information that is often hidden away in books, archives, or lengthy reports and present it in a way that feels relatable, entertaining, and easy to consume. Each piece of content starts with a question and then breaks down the answer through storytelling, research, and historical context.

Ultimately, Wah I Neva Kno is about preserving Caymanian culture through digital media while encouraging curiosity, conversation, and a deeper appreciation for who we are as a people. It demonstrates how social media and digital storytelling can be used not just for entertainment, but as powerful tools for education and cultural preservation 🇰🇾✨
